Alice Joyce née Jordan,
Magherafadda, Ballyheane, Castlebar, Co. Mayo and formerly of Clogher, Breaffy, Castlebar - on 5th February 2025, peacefully at Mayo University Hospital, in her 88th year.
Dearly loved wife of Joseph and dearly loved mother of Christopher (Castlebar) and Valerie (Ballyheane).
Predeceased by her parents Martin and Ellen (née Parkinson) and her brothers Paddy, Willie, John Martin and her sister Bridie.
She will be sadly missed by her heartbroken husband, her son, her daughter, her daughter-in-law Mary and Valerie’s partner Kevin, by her cherished grandchildren Deirdre, Leah, Catherine and Jessica, her Godchild Connie and Connie’s husband Kevin and their children Martin and Jayden, her sister Eileen and her husband Ray (U.K) and her sister Freda (U.K), her nephews, nieces, cousins, relatives and friends.
May she rest in peace.
In her younger day Alice worked in Lavelle’s Bakery in Castlebar and later in St. Mary’s Hospital, Castlebar where she was held in high esteem by her work colleagues and all she came in contact with. She loved listening to music and she also enjoyed dancing. Alice was a great animal lover and she took great care of her dogs and her hens. In her spare time she enjoyed listening to the radio and reading the paper. She was very well regarded in the Ballyheane area and she will be greatly missed by all who had the pleasure of knowing her.
